The HCA Healthcare Nurse Residency is a year-long program designed to give you hands-on experience, helping establish valuable clinical and critical thinking skills. You will be surrounded by a supportive community of nurse educators, experienced nurses, and fellow residents that promote learning, clinical application, and socialization, shepherding you through the transition from student nurse to registered nurse.

1 Accepted Application
The first step is an accepted application once it’s been submitted.
2 Interviews & Selection
After your application has been accepted, you’ll be contacted for an in-person or phone interview.
3 Candidate Notification
If you are selected after the interview, you will be notified via email and job dashboard.
4 Offer Letters Mailed
You will receive an official offer letter in the mail to formally accept the position.
5 Cohort Start Date
It’s official! The start date is now set and you’ll soon be creating healthier tomorrows!
Nurse Residency Program Eligibility Requirements
We accept applications from nursing students who are preparing to graduate within the next six months or graduate nursing students who have six months or less of experience at the time of application.
